This book critically analyses the basic questions regarding the principle of beneficence within its moral domain, to suggest and work out a more credible form of Principle of Beneficence. The Moral Quest for a More Credible Principle of Beneficence evolves from the common goodness of the three major confronting theories of ethics, i.e., Utilitarianism, Deontology, and Virtue Ethics. After analysing and exploring the common ground of the three views, the aim is to prescribe a more convincing form of the principle of beneficence.
The book starts with a brief discussion of the principle of beneficence and then critically analyses previous views related to the principle of beneficence, virtue of benevolence, and their relationship, and proposes a more credible form of the Principle of Beneficence. The Moral Quest for a More Credible Principle of Beneficence aims to provide a significant contribution towards the theory of beneficence.
